Transaction 8257fb3262ddbad0ed1c2f4b7039e54444ab962e351bb0f94fcdea15e2f12d30

1 Input
1 Outputs
  • 8257fb3262ddbad0ed1c2f4b7039e54444ab962e351bb0f94fcdea15e2f12d30:0
  • value  568634
    address  3MHdWWbhGAvsGZTXMBW7GRvn64jT7GSiw7